Note

VE.Can 3 phase networking differs from VE.Bus. Please read the documentation in full, even if you have experience with large VE.Bus systems.

Mixing different models of Inverter RS (ie. the model with Solar and without Solar) is possible. However mixing Inverter RS with Multi RS is not currently supported.

DC and AC wiring

Each unit needs to be fused individually on the AC and DC side. Make sure to use the same type of fuse on each unit.

The complete system must be wired to a single battery bank. We do not currently support multiple different battery banks for one connected 3 phase system.

Communication wiring

All units must be daisy chained with a VE.Can cable (RJ45 cat5, cat5e, or cat6). The sequence for this is not important.

Terminators must be used at both ends of the VE.Can network.

The temperature sensor can be wired to any unit in the system. For a large battery bank it is possible to wire multiple temperature sensors. The system will use the one with the highest temperature to determine the temperature compensation.

Programming

Settings need to be set manually by changing the settings in each device. However, some of the settings related to three phase operation can be propagated to other units with System settings sync.System

Charger settings (voltage and current limits) are overridden if DVCC is configured and if a BMS-Can BMS is active in the system.

System Monitoring

It is strongly recommended that a GX Family Product is used in conjunction with these larger systems. They provide highly valuable information on the history and performance of the system.

System notifications are clearly presented and many additional functions are enabled. Data from VRM will greatly speed support if it is required.
